Abstract

To improve the feasibility and efficiency of ultra-precision surface structuring, a closed-loop fast-tool-servo (FTS) surface patterning and measurement system is developed with functional modules of feature-based tool path generation, embedded surface measurement and integrated surface characterisation toolkit. A dedicate controller HUDCNC is developed for the process control of FTS surface patterning and on-machine surface measurement (OMSM). Algorithms are developed for data formatting and transformation of designed patterns into the FTS cutting points (maximum number of 5 million points). The feasibility and performance of the proposed closed-loop FTS machining system are demonstrated by successfully generating typical functional structured surfaces including periodic structures, patterns and tessellations, biological surfaces, profile and character combinations. The results indicate that the feature-based FTS patterning and surface characterisation system provides a promising solution to the design and manufacturing of high-precision functional structured surfaces. The integrated OMSM system and the surface characterisation toolkit allow the fast inspection and quality control of the machined functional surfaces.
